智能分析软件如何重塑编程未来

最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E

标题:智能分析软件如何重塑编程未来

在当今数字化快速发展的时代,软件开发的复杂性和需求量呈指数级增长。传统的编程方式已难以满足现代开发者的需求,尤其是在面对日益复杂的项目和紧迫的交付期限时。此时,智能化工具的出现为开发者带来了前所未有的便利和效率提升。本文将探讨智能分析软件如何通过集成AI技术,从根本上改变编程流程,并介绍一款引领这一变革的创新产品。

智能化编程:从理想到现实

随着人工智能(AI)技术的迅猛发展,越来越多的企业开始探索将其应用于软件开发领域。智能分析软件不仅能够帮助开发者自动生成代码、优化性能,还能提供实时错误检测与修复建议。这些功能极大地简化了编程过程,使开发者可以更专注于创意和技术架构的设计,而不是繁琐的编码细节。

例如,在处理大型项目时,智能分析软件可以通过全局改写功能理解整个项目的结构,并根据需求生成或修改多个文件,包括生成图片资源等。这不仅提高了工作效率,还减少了人为错误的发生概率。此外,AI驱动的智能问答系统允许用户通过自然对话与工具互动,解决了许多编程难题,如代码解析、语法指导、编写测试案例等。

应用场景一:初学者的福音

对于编程新手来说,学习一门新的编程语言往往是一个充满挑战的过程。他们需要花费大量时间来掌握基本语法和逻辑思维能力。而智能分析软件则为这些初学者提供了一个轻松入门的好帮手。以某大学计算机专业的大作业为例,学生需要完成一个图书借阅系统的开发任务。借助于内置的AI对话框,即使是没有任何开发经验的学生也能通过简单的自然语言交流快速实现代码补全、生成注释等功能。这样一来,学生们不仅能够顺利完成作业,还能在此过程中积累宝贵的经验。

应用场景二:企业级应用开发

在企业环境中,项目通常涉及多个团队协作,且要求高效地完成各项任务。智能分析软件的强大之处在于它能够适应各种规模和类型的项目。无论是构建小型Web应用程序还是复杂的企业管理系统,该类工具都能显著提高团队的整体生产力。比如,在创建一个声音光效灵动的小型游戏时,开发者只需输入具体需求至AI对话框中,软件即可迅速生成符合要求的完整代码。如果遇到运行时的问题,还可以将错误信息反馈给AI助手进行查错修正,确保项目顺利推进。

应用场景三:跨平台开发支持

现代应用程序常常需要部署在不同操作系统上,这就要求开发者具备跨平台开发的能力。然而,由于各平台之间的差异性较大,使得这一目标变得异常困难。幸运的是,某些智能分析软件已经在这方面取得了重大突破。它们不仅兼容多种编程语言和框架,还支持VSCode插件及CodeArts自定义插件框架,从而实现了真正的跨平台开发体验。这意味着无论是在Windows、macOS还是Linux环境下工作,开发者都可以享受到一致的操作界面和强大的功能集。

引领未来的创新者——新一代AI编程工具

上述提到的所有优势都集中体现在了一款名为InsCode AI IDE的产品上。这款由CSDN、GitCode和华为云CodeArts IDE联合开发的新一代AI跨平台集成开发环境,旨在为全球开发者提供最先进、最便捷的编程解决方案。其前端采用了VSCode Monaco Editor和部分视图组件,后端则基于Python自主研发,涵盖了索引系统、语言模型、补全、调试等多个方面。前后端通过extended LSP协议通讯,e-lsp在LSP协议基础上扩展了UI消息类型、消息proxy和caching机制,同时兼容VSCode API。

InsCode AI IDE不仅拥有出色的性能表现,更重要的是它真正做到了让编程变得更加简单有趣。无论是代码生成、补全、智能问答还是错误修复等功能,都能帮助用户大幅提升开发效率。特别是最新集成的DeepSeek-V3模型,更是将智能编程推向了一个新高度。通过内置的DeepSeek模块,InsCode AI IDE能够更精准地理解开发者的需求,提供更加智能的代码生成和优化建议。这不仅简化了编程过程,还节省了申请和配置的时间成本,而且是完全免费提供的!

结语

智能分析软件正在逐渐成为每个开发者不可或缺的得力助手。它不仅改变了我们编写代码的方式,也为整个行业带来了革命性的变化。如果你也想体验这种前所未有的编程乐趣,请立即下载并试用InsCode AI IDE。相信你一定会爱上这款充满智慧与创新的工具,开启属于你的高效编程之旅!

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

内容概要:本文围绕可变桨叶四旋翼无人机的规范控制与点对点运动模拟展开,重点研究优化推力分配策略在翻转动作中的应用与性能比较。通过Matlab代码实现,构建了四旋翼动力学模型,并设计了多种控制算法以实现精确的姿态调整与轨迹跟踪。研究对比了不同推力分配方案在执行高机动性翻转动作时的稳定性、能耗效率与响应速度,旨在提升无人机在复杂飞行任务中的动态性能与控制精度。该仿真研究为无人机飞控系统的设计与优化提供了理论依据和技术支持。; 适合人群:具备一定自动控制理论基础和Matlab编程能力,从事无人机控制、飞行器动力学或机器人系统研究的科研人员及研究生。; 使用场景及目标:① 实现四旋翼无人机在三维空间中的精确点对点运动控制;② 对比分析不同推力分配策略在执行翻转等高难度动作时的控制效果与能耗表现,优化飞行性能;③ 为无人机自主飞行、特技飞行及复杂环境下的机动控制提供算法验证平台。; 阅读建议:此资源以Matlab仿真为核心,建议读者结合相关控制理论知识,深入理解代码实现细节,重点关注动力学建模、控制律设计与推力分配模块。在学习过程中,应动手调试参数,复现文中翻转动作的仿真结果,并尝试拓展至其他复杂飞行任务,以加深对无人机控制机理的理解。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

inscode_006

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值